National Instruments PXIe-5601 RF Signal Downconverter
The NI PXIe-5601 (Part Numbers: 780411-01, 199080D-01L) downconverts an RF signal to an intermediate frequency. This model can be used in combination with the PXIe-5622 IF Digitizer Module and the PXI-5652 LO Source Module. These three modules combined create the PXIe-5663 RF Vector Signal Analyzer with Digital Downconversion. The PXIe-5601 can be placed in either a PXI Express peripheral slot or a PXI Express Hybrid peripheral slot.
This RF Signal Downconverter is sensitive to ESD and transients. The user should only apply external signals when the NI PXIe-5601 is powered on because applying external signals when the instrument is off may harm the module. The user should note that the instrument may exceed safe handling temperatures and may result in burns if they have been operating the module. Therefore, the user should let the RF Signal Downconverter cool prior to touching the shield or taking the instrument from the chassis. In addition, it is always recommended to be properly grounded when handling cables or antennas attached to the PXIe-5601 module.
This RF Signal Downconverter has four connectors and two LEDs. The first front panel connector is the RF IN connector, which links to the analog RF input signal to be measured by the NI-5663. The next front panel connector is the IF OUT connector, which links to the IF IN connector on the PXIe-5622 module’s front panel. The third connector, LO IN, links to the RF OUT connector on the PXI-5652 LO Source Module’s front panel. Lastly, the LO OUT connector exports the signal received at LO IN to other PXIe-5601 modules for multichannel systems.

National Instruments PXIe-5601 Frequently Asked Questions
Question: What is the maximum safe DC voltage for the PXIe-5601?
Answer: The maximum safe DC voltage for the PXIe-5601 is ±5 V.
Question: How often should the NI PXIe-5601 be calibrated?
Answer: The NI PXIe-5601 should be calibrated every year.
Question: What are the power requirements for the PXIe 5601?
Answer: The power requirements for the PXIe 5601 are 640 mA at +3.3 VDC and 740 mA at -12 VDC.
